Louhi
Louhi is a queen of the land known as Pohjola in Finnish mythology and the mythology of Lapland.
Read more about Louhi.
Related Phrases
Related Words
Louhi is a queen of the land known as Pohjola in Finnish mythology and the mythology of Lapland.
Read more about Louhi.